#f372b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f372b2 is composed of 95.3% red, 44.7%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.1% magenta, 26.7%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 330.2 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 70%. #f372b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4ff with #e70065.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#f372b2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f372b2 has RGB values of R:243, G:114,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.27,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15954610.

Shades and Tints of #f372b2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040002 is the darkest color, while #fef1f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f372b2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8adb2 is the less saturated color, while #ff66b2 is the most saturated one.
